While the original is a soulful stomp of defiance, Linkin Park’s rendition is a fragile piano ballad. It serves as a reminder that great songs are shapeshifters.
Linkin Park’s 2011 cover of Adele’s "Rolling in the Deep" remains a haunting highlight of their legacy. Recorded live at the iTunes Festival in London, it stripped away the nu-metal aggression the band was known for, revealing a raw, vulnerable core.
